Transaction 22175a029939f9176eb427797b15509997628950d789d5a7b20d5ee0179e636e
1 Input
2 Outputs
- 22175a029939f9176eb427797b15509997628950d789d5a7b20d5ee0179e636e:0
- 22175a029939f9176eb427797b15509997628950d789d5a7b20d5ee0179e636e:1
value 1708823113
address 3FT1eiPifxpubhCDJtearXEvZocY6Ez1Km
value 21170214
address 1NdfxkQSN1gjWRAFGqGsHuSmL1KzEWwW6i